The Entrance Pavilion
You can reach the Alhambra Palace on foot or by public transportation. Buses C30 and C32 take you to the palace. Once you get off the bus, you can see the main entrance a few meters. If you go on foot, start in Plaza Nueva in Granada. Standing next to the fountain in the middle of the square and facing the church of Santa Ana, turn right and head towards “Cuesta de Gomérez” street, which goes uphill. After about 5 minutes going up, you will find the Renaissance Gate of the Pomegranates. Once you pass through the gate, you will see three tree-lined paths: take the one on your right or the middle one. Go ahead and after about 10 minutes you will come across the Entrance Pavilion, the main ticket office and visitor entrance of the Alhambra Palace, where you can pay the additional fee or pick up your ticket and enter the complex.
